Report: Rumoured Spurs target spent last weekend in London for talks

Rumoured Tottenham target Ilaix Moriba spent last weekend in London with his representatives ahead of a potential exit from Barcelona, according to Mundo Deportivo.

The La Masia academy graduate is currently in an awkward position with the Catalan side, with the club’s chiefs informing him he will be frozen out of the first team after refusing to sign a new deal.

With one year remaining on his current deal, the Daily Mail claim Spurs have held tentative talks with the 18-year-old’s representatives, but face stiff competition from the likes of Chelsea, Manchester City and RB Leipzig.

However, Mundo Deportivo believe Moriba and his agents have been in London over the weekend talking to clubs over a potential transfer for the £21m-rated teenager.

The report claims Spurs were not involved in discussions on this occasion, but Chelsea indeed were, with the club’s chiefs monitoring Moriba’s situation closely.

Chelsea could be the likeliest side to structure a deal in the way that Barcelona would like, with the Catalan giants reportedly willing to negotiate with the west London side.
